​How Do I Deal with Local OSHA Compliance for AGV Forklifts Imported from China

When companies import AGV forklifts from China into the United States, safety compliance is one of the most important evaluation factors before deployment.

Unlike traditional warehouse equipment, autonomous forklifts combine mechanical systems, sensors, software and industrial control technologies. Companies must ensure that the AGV system meets local workplace safety requirements and can pass internal EHS reviews.

Why OSHA Compliance Matters for Imported AGV Forklifts

For US companies, warehouse automation projects must consider OSHA workplace safety requirements, especially regulations related to powered industrial trucks and material handling equipment.

Before importing autonomous forklifts from China, companies should evaluate:

  • AGV safety functions and emergency stopping capability

  • Pedestrian protection systems

  • Risk assessment documentation

  • Electrical installation requirements

  • Operator and maintenance training materials

Do Chinese AGV Forklifts Comply with OSHA 1910.178 Requirements?

OSHA 1910.178 focuses on powered industrial trucks and workplace safety practices. Companies deploying autonomous forklifts should evaluate how the AGV system addresses equivalent safety concerns.

Important safety functions may include:

  • Emergency stop buttons

  • Obstacle detection sensors

  • Speed limitation zones

  • Automatic braking functions

  • Audible and visual warning systems

  • Safe interaction between AGVs and pedestrians

The final compliance requirements depend on the facility layout, application conditions and local safety evaluation process.

What Technical Documents Should Chinese AGV Suppliers Provide?

Large companies usually require complete technical documentation before approving new automation equipment.

Common documentation includes:

  • AGV user manuals

  • Electrical wiring diagrams

  • Safety circuit documentation

  • Mechanical drawings

  • Maintenance instructions

  • Risk assessment reports

  • Software operation manuals

Providing complete documentation helps local engineering and safety teams evaluate installation requirements and maintenance procedures.

Are Chinese AGV Electrical Panels and Chargers UL or ETL Listed?

Electrical compliance is another important concern when installing imported automation equipment in US facilities.

Companies should confirm:

  • Electrical cabinet specifications

  • Charger input voltage requirements

  • Component certification information

  • Applicable US electrical installation standards

  • Local electrician approval requirements

Some projects may require UL or ETL listed components depending on customer requirements and local installation regulations.

What Safety Markings Are Required for AGV Operating Areas?

A warehouse using autonomous forklifts should clearly define the interaction area between AGVs and employees.

Common safety measures include:

  • AGV operating zone markings

  • Pedestrian walking lanes

  • Warning signs

  • Restricted access areas

  • Emergency stop locations

  • Safety barriers when required

How Do AGVs Improve Warehouse Safety Compared with Manual Forklifts?

One major reason companies adopt autonomous forklifts is reducing risks caused by human-operated forklift activities.

Potential safety improvements include:

  • Controlled vehicle speed

  • Consistent driving behavior

  • Reduced collision risk

  • Automatic obstacle detection

  • Digital operation records

What Should US Companies Prepare Before AGV Installation?

Before deploying imported AGV forklifts, companies should prepare a compliance checklist.

Evaluation AreaRequired Preparation
Safety DocumentationManuals, risk assessment and technical files
Electrical InstallationConfirm charger and power requirements
Warehouse LayoutDefine AGV routes and pedestrian areas
Employee TrainingProvide AGV operation and safety training

Questions to Ask Chinese AGV Suppliers About OSHA Compliance

  • Can you provide complete safety documentation?

  • Do your AGVs support international safety standards?

  • Can you provide electrical drawings for US installation?

  • Are chargers and electrical components suitable for US facilities?

  • Do you provide risk assessment reports?

  • Can you support customer EHS approval processes?

Final Thoughts

OSHA compliance is an essential part of importing AGV forklifts from China into the United States. Successful deployment requires more than purchasing autonomous vehicles; companies need complete documentation, appropriate safety design and cooperation between suppliers and local safety teams.

By evaluating compliance requirements before installation, companies can reduce project risks and build a safer automated warehouse environment.
